Socinian

so·ci·nian

UK/soʊˈsɪn.iː.ən/ uncommon

noun

1.

an adherent of the teachings of Socinus; a Christian who rejects the divinity of Christ and the Trinity and original sin; influenced the development of Unitarian theology

Origin

Borrowed from New Latin Sociniānus.
